NFL PREVIEW
Andrew Luck may need a little, well, luck.
The Indianapolis Colts’ young quarterback has faced the New England Patriots three times and the results have been less lovely than Luck’s bushy beard. It’s Patriots 3, Colts 0, by a combined score of 144-66.
That’s one of the story lines in battle Sunday for the AFC championship and a Super Bowl berth.
Here’s another: If the Patriots win, they will go to the Super Bowl for a record-tying eighth time. A victory over the Colts would mark coach Bill Belichick’s NFL-record 21st playoff win. The Patriots have beaten the Colts five straight times, including playoffs.
The AFC championship game in Foxborough, Mass., will be televised by CBS, with a scheduled kickoff time of 6:40 p.m. ET.
In the NFC matchup, the Green Bay Packers visit the Seattle Seahawks, who are the defending Super Bowl champions. The season began with those two meeting in Seattle and the Seahawks coming away with a 36-16 victory.
“This team, from Week 1, has grown a lot,” Packers tight end Andrew Quarless says.
The Elias Sports Bureau, the NFL’s official keeper of statistics, notes that this is only the second time that a conference championship game will feature the league’s top-scoring offense (Green Bay) and top scoring defense (Seattle). The only other time was in 1980 (the high-scoring Dallas Cowboys vs. the penurious Philadelphia Eagles).
The game kicks off at 3:05 p.m. ET and is televised by Fox. Super Bowl XLIX (49) is set for University of Phoenix Stadium in Glendale, Ariz., on Feb. 1.
The picks
New England 37, Indianapolis 30. Tom Brady gets to add to his Super Bowl legacy. … Seattle 23, Green Bay 20. A field goal in the final minute allows the Seahawks the chance to repeat.
